The locksmith will remove pins from the door knob, lever or deadbolt, and replace them with matching pins. The lock is reassembled and tested to ensure that it works properly. You might need to reset your locks if you've moved into an apartment or if you're looking to upgrade your security system. Rekeying is a cheaper alternative to replacing the entire lock, because it is only a matter of changing the internal pins. Additionally, rekeying can keep the old keys from working on your lock. As opposed to traditional locks, the electronic or smart lock makes use of microchips to connect with the vehicle's computer. Electronic or smart locks can be opened using the use of a remote control, key card or mobile application. You can also set up a pin that will unlock your smart or electronic lock. Mobile auto locksmiths are now able to make a spare key on the spot. Broken window boards If you've got a broken window, it's a good idea to take some steps to stop burglars from accessing your home. The best way to protect yourself regardless of whether your window is broken or damaged completely is to cover it with wood or card. This will keep you safe from shattered glasses and severe weather until you can replace the window. You'll also require tape to keep the boards in place, like duct or masking tape. Wear protective eyewear and gloves before beginning. You should also clean up the area around the broken windows. Remove any sharp glass pieces and dispose of them in the trash. After that, carefully look at the cracks in the glass to determine if they're sturdy enough to remain in place. If they're strong enough, you can cover them with cardboard or tape. After you've finished measuring, you can then begin taking measurements of the width and height of the window frame. This will help you determine what size of replacement material you require to purchase. Use the tape measure to take the measurements and then write them down.
